Country: United Arab Emirates
Address: Office Land Building - 1 Suite 103 - Al Karama
Website: http://galaxyship.com
On site since: May 5, 2025
United Arab Emirates
2311 Floor 23 Clover Bay tower, Business Bay
United Arab Emirates
Al Khalidiyah - Abu Dhabi - United Arab Emirates
United Arab Emirates
P.O.Box: 45877 Abu Dhabi, UAE